Responsibilities
* Program (Fanuc), set up, and operate CNC turning machines to manufacture precision components to specification.
* Prepare and load raw materials, carry out test runs, and adjust settings as needed.
* Inspect and measure finished parts using precision instruments to ensure compliance with drawings and tolerances.
* Perform routine machine maintenance and troubleshoot minor issues to minimise downtime.
* Maintain high standards of quality, safety, and efficiency, while contributing to continuous improvement.
Qualifications
* Time-served apprenticeship or equivalent qualification in CNC machining/engineering.
* Proven experience as a CNC Turner with strong knowledge of Fanuc controls.
* Skilled in setting, programming, and operating CNC lathes.
* Confident in reading and interpreting engineering drawings and working to tight tolerances.
*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and ability to work independently or within a team.
